I'm excited about this guy. He was a 3rd rounder in 2005, great college career at La Tech, Philly drafted him thinking they might find another Westbrook type player. Seems like he got injured in either his 2nd or 3rd season or both and Philly lost patience with him. Obviously he isn't Westbrook but I think this guy can be a strong number two for us in the post Ahman Green world. Also wouldn't be surprised to see him do some return work, the dude is pretty fast. Actually he has a lot of similarities to Slaton.
